Output 8e3deb6ae8c44fc74cfe1c1f674b331cc1c0bcdb7d98acaa38fc267a1ae92623:0

value
17158888
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ad8ad82583ebd3a804339700747f3c621f0861a OP_EQUAL
address
374AghrxDX7U7yo8JUgqsfa3jrsqsAWh8v
transaction
8e3deb6ae8c44fc74cfe1c1f674b331cc1c0bcdb7d98acaa38fc267a1ae92623
spent
true